What is the concentration of hydrogen ion in the solution when the concentration of hydroxyl ion is 0.08 mol / dm^3 at 298 K ?

B. 0.125 10^ -12 mol/L
At 298 K, the ionic product of water is K_w = [H^+][OH^-] = 1.0 10^ -14 . Given [OH^-] = 0.08 mol/dm^3 = 0.08 mol/L. [H^+] = K_w [OH^-] = 1.0 10^ -14 0.08 [H^+] = 1 8 10^ -12 = 0.125 10^ -12 mol/L. Answer: 0.125 10^ -12 mol/L
